Recycling is a big part of life in San Francisco and we're proud to have one of the best programs in the nation. Our recycling collection program is "commingled" or "single stream" which means that all recyclable materials, such as paper, glass, plastic, and metal are accepted in one collection container or cart. The materials are then sent to Recycle Central, located at Pier 96 on San Francisco's Southern waterfront, where they are separated into commodities that are sold to manufacturers that turn our discards into new products.

We can recycle and compost almost everything in San Francisco and our programs are available for residents, businesses, and city government. But even with a world-class recycling program, our 2005 Waste Characterization Study found that 30% of the material we send to landfill should be recycled instead.

Stop Trashing the Climate
This report documents the link between climate change and unsustainable patterns of consumption and wasting, dispels myths about the climate benefits of landfill gas recovery and waste incineration, outlines policies needed to effect change, and offers a roadmap for how to significantly reduce gre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ions within a short period.
